In the presence of Ni(cod)2, a dicyclohexylbenzimidazolium chloride, and NaOt-Bu, alkenyl-substituted N-Boc-N-benzyl benzamides containing tri- or tetrasubstituted alkene moieties such as I underwent chemoselective Mizoroki-Heck cyclizations to yield α-alkenyl indanones such as II containing quaternary carbon centers in 51-93% average yields without decarbonylation. A dimethylbutenyl-substituted N-Boc-N-benzyl benzamide underwent diastereoselective Mizoroki-Heck cyclization to form a vinyldimethylindanone in 80% yield and in 92:8 dr.
